There’s no credible evidence or reputable reporting to support the claim that Pittsburgh Pirates legend Andrew McCutchen has turned down a $750 million contract offer from any Kentucky-based team. Here’s what verified sources reveal:

What We Actually Know

Recent Contract Signing

As of December 23, 2024, McCutchen agreed to a one‑year deal worth $5 million with the Pittsburgh Pirates for the 2025 season .

His 2025 salary is confirmed to be $5 million, with no reports of any massive offers being declined .

Career Summary

McCutchen, a five-time All-Star and 2013 NL MVP, is near the end of an illustrious career and remains with the Pirates as a veteran leader DH .

There is zero mention of any $750 million offer or involvement with a Kentucky-based team in authoritative outlets like the Associated Press, Forbes, Bleacher Report, or his official contract listings .

Conclusion: This Claim Is False

Neither mainstream sports media nor official records mention such an offer.

The verified contract is a modest one-year, $5 million extension with the Pirates—not $750 million.

It’s almost certainly fabricated or satirical, with no factual basis.
